I am using Powerpoint 2003 with SP1 installed and have acquired image files,
first in both jpeg and then bmp formats. These images will not open in
Powerpoint but open perfectly in all other programs (Word, Photoshop,
Picassa and other very basic products).

I have no antivirus programs running and have unrestricted access. The
message I get is:

Powerpoint cannot open the file represented by..................

I have copied these files to other drive locations with the same result.

Any thoughts on what might be happening would be greatly appreciated.

Yup. PowerPoint doesn't open image files .. instead, choose Insert, Picture,
From File and bring in your pictures that way.

Use File, Open to open PowerPoint files.
